Reporting the French presidential election
What were the challenges in reporting a divisive French presidential election? Plus a listener asks why she is being asked to create a BBC account when logging on online?
The French presidential elections have dominated many of the headlines in the past few weeks - but what are the challenges in reporting what was seen by many to be a divisive election? We hear your views and ask the editor of Newshour how balance was maintained.
Plus a listener asks why she’s being asked to create a BBC account when logging on online.
